A novel class of fulgimide, (Z)-4-oxazolylfulgimide ((Z)-1-benzyl-4-isopropylidene-3-[1-(2-aryl-5-methyl-oxazolyl)ethylidene]tetrahydropyrrole-2,5-dione), was synthesized by the reaction of (Z)-4-oxazolyl fulgide (4-isopropylidene-3-[1-(2-aryl-5-methyloxazolyl)ethylidene]tetrahydrofuran-2,5-dione) with benzyl amine. Photo-chromic property of (Z)-4-oxazolylfulgimide was studied. Compared with (Z)-4-oxazolylfulgide, the absorption maximum of the colored form of (Z)-4-oxazolylfulgimide is bathochromic-shifted. Substituents on the aryl ring af-fect the absorption maximum of the open form and the colored form of (Z)-4-oxazolylfulgimide.
